
Overview
A crook with big feet buys shoes that are too tight from a salesman, then decides to use the store as a front for illegal gambling.
Frequently Asked Questions & Story Details
Who directed Tight Shoes?
Tight Shoes was directed by Albert S. Rogell.
Where was Tight Shoes produced?
It was produced by companies including Universal Pictures, Mayfair Productions Inc. in United States of America.
